EV Automobile Distance
A key factor for many prospective buyers considering a battery electric vehicle is its extent. The usable range an EV can cover on a single full charge has increased significantly in recent years, with many models now offering over 250 miles. However, real-world distance can be affected by numerous conditions, including operating habits, weather, terrain, and even the use of systems like heating or air climate control. It’s crucial for prospective EV drivers to carefully evaluate these impacts and budget accordingly to avoid unexpected situations.

Plug-in Hybrid Electric Vehicle
Plug-in hybrid electric vehicles, or PHEVs, represent a compelling bridge between conventional gasoline-powered cars and fully electric-powered models. They combine a gasoline engine with a rechargeable battery pack, offering drivers a remarkable degree of flexibility. This allows for shorter commutes and errands to be completed using only electricity, significantly reducing fuel consumption and emissions. For longer journeys, the gasoline engine seamlessly takes over, eliminating range anxiety. The ability to plug-in to an external power source to replenish the battery also encourages a more sustainable driving lifestyle and offers potential savings on fuel costs, dependent on driving routines and access to charging infrastructure.
